The Holme Valley Transport Scheme
To provide transport facilities in the Holme Valley, West Yorkshire, for people who have need of such a facility because they are elderly, poor or disabled, people with young children or those living in isolated areas where there are no adequate public facilities to enable such persons to attend primary healthcare facilities for essential and/or routine healthcare and treatment

How much income did The Holme Valley Transport Scheme report in 2025?
The Holme Valley Transport Scheme reported total income of £21k and reported expenditure of £22k for the financial year ending 2025, based on the most recent annual return filed with the Charity Commission.
When was The Holme Valley Transport Scheme registered as a charity?
The Holme Valley Transport Scheme was registered with the Charity Commission for England and Wales on 17 May 2007 as charity number 1119261. It has been registered for 19 years.
Who runs The Holme Valley Transport Scheme?
The Holme Valley Transport Scheme is governed by a board of 4 trustees. Trustees are legally responsible for the charity's governance and are listed in full on its profile.
Where does The Holme Valley Transport Scheme operate?
The Holme Valley Transport Scheme operates in Kirklees, as recorded in its Charity Commission filing.
